Abstract
- The performance of a time-division multiple-access mobile radio system adopting slow frequency-hopping is analyzed by following an original procedure that allows the evaluation of thermal noise and fast fading (e.g., Rayleigh) effects on block-coded transmission with non-ideal interleaving. Starting from this approach, service coverage can be analytically evaluated when the "slow" disturbances affecting the transmission are fixed. The method proposed is able to take several impairments into account, such as shadowing and discontinuous transmission, as will be shown in the companion paper.
